Transaction 5cb5f9dc72de9b719631681f2ce1e5d0ce02ddc58b024ec768568b65c97fa4a4
3 Input
1 Outputs
- 5cb5f9dc72de9b719631681f2ce1e5d0ce02ddc58b024ec768568b65c97fa4a4:0
value 1282463648
address 3KfPMkgs8e9TYp9KrFNTbVVewY3GhzSNTV